Juliene Shea's Obituary
Juliene Shea 90, of West Mineral, KS formerly of Grove, Oklahoma passed away January 29, 2021 at Mercy Hospital in Joplin, MO
She was born on March 1, 1930 to Edwin and Lucille Williams.
She was a member of St. Bridget's Catholic Church, Scammon, Kansas where she was formerly an organist.
Juliene served the City of West Mineral for 24 years having been a councilperson, Mayor, City Treasurer and lastly the City Clerk.
She was a charter member of F.O.E. #918 Auxiliary of West Mineral.
She was employed for 18 years at Day & Zimmermann, Army Ammunition Plant in Parsons, Kansas.
Juliene is survived by her husband, Tim of the home, one daughter, Marcie Getman of West Mineral, two sons, Randy Shea of West Mineral and Richard Villa of Kansas City, MO; three granddaughters, 12 great grandchildren, 3 great-great grandchildren and one sister, Marilyn Scott of Columbus, KS.
